Lakers Still Not Totally in Sync
The Los Angeles Lakers have been dealing with chemistry issues since adding guard Russell Westbrook before the 2021-22 campaign. Teaming Westbrook with LeBron James and Anthony Davis gave the Lakers three players that are best with the ball in their hands, so it’s been a growing process. New head coach Darvin Ham will try bringing Westbrook off the bench in Friday’s contest to head the team’s second unit in an effort to maximize all three players’ offensive capabilities.
Los Angeles is hoping to have turned the corner, with all three players having the green light to go for their own offense if they see an opening, but it has yet to translate into many wins in the preseason. The Lakers have high expectations for themselves, but until they prove they can play together, the rest of the NBA world will have doubts.
James continues to impress at age 37, coming off a season in which he averaged 30.3 points, 8.2 rebounds, and 6.2 assists per game. He’ll continue to be the leader of this team as long as he’s on it, though he’s good at getting his teammates involved as well.
Davis has dealt with multiple injuries over the last few seasons, but the hope is he’ll be healthy for the start of the regular season. Davis played just 40 games in 2021-22 but averaged 23.2 points, 9.9 rebounds, 3.1 assists, 2.3 blocks, and 1.2 steals when he was in the lineup.
Kings Hope Preseason Success Translates Over
The Sacramento Kings are playing very well right now, but it is the preseason, so it won’t help the team’s quest to get to the playoffs. Still, the pieces are coming together, from rookie Keegan Murray to forward Domantas Sabonis, who was acquired midway through the 2021-22 season, to guard De’Aaron Fox, who leads the team in scoring.
Guard Terence Davis has been impressive in the preseason and should be another scoring threat for the Kings. Davis had 12 points off the bench in a win over the Phoenix Suns on Wednesday, hitting 3-of-5 3-point attempts.

Murray is a popular Rookie of the Year pick after being the No. 4 pick in this year’s draft. The forward has shown some pre-season flashes and will be moving into a bigger role as the season progresses.
Fox will be a key to the Kings’ hopes for a postseason berth. The 24-year-old is coming off a season in which he averaged 23.2 points and 5.6 assists, and he is the team’s acknowledged leader.
Lakers vs Kings Head-To-Head
The Sacramento Kings routed the Los Angeles Lakers in the preseason’s first meeting between the clubs, winning by 30 points. The Kings were helped by the fact that James, Davis, and Westbrook all played 16 or fewer minutes in the contest.
The rivals split their season series a year ago, with each team going 1-1 at home. However, looking at the NBA lines for this contest, the host Kings are getting the edge to come away with the win.
